He’s not been sleeping well, these past few weeks. A wyvern stalks his dreams, following him through each dark twist of a maze where the hedges fade into row upon row of books, and both their feet echo on the library floors. At the edges of his vision there are licks of flame, but they are never there when he turns to look. Somewhere ahead of him, he knows, is the wiseman, but the wiseman will not help him - only pose a riddle, and laugh when he can’t answer.

Charlemagne wakes to the sound of that laughing when the light is still feeble and silver. He wakes alone, as he has every morning since arriving to the Dawn Court, and he stretches and shakes the tension out and slips as quiet as he can toward the courtyard and the fields. He likes seeing the sun come up (as surely most of them do) - for him it’s a reassurance. He is safe here, even if he is not…not quite happy.

Even so, hope builds in him as he takes in the proud walls, the careful placement of each stone in the courtyard, the way the dawn washes it all in gold. It’s clear this place was built with sunrise in mind, made to welcome it.

He’s nearly to the gates when he hears the first good morning, and something about the voice is naggingly familiar, but it’s muffled by distance. It’s not until he, like Ipomoea, rounds a turn and sees her that he realizes why he knows the voice. It’s her. The girl with the dagger, the girl with the grinning insults.

Florentine, the paint sage cries, quite happily, just as Charlemagne opens his mouth to say something far less welcoming. The unicorn shuts it again and huffs a breath, unsure how he feels about the pegasus being greeted so terribly fondly. That, and wasn’t Florentine the name that Pan had mentioned, almost reverently? Clearly the experiences others had had with her differed quite a bit from his own.

His first impulse is to turn away, but he doesn’t allow himself to; he is not a coward, he is not, he is not. He survived the maze, survived the dragon, survived the desert and Bexley. He would survive a second encounter with the girl.

Instead of saying anything, the young stallion only watches her from across the courtyard, neck arched and expression as brooding as he could make it.
